<title>feat(cli): do not require config file to run CLI</title>

BREAKING CHANGE: A config file is no longer needed to run
the CLI. python-gitlab will default to https://gitlab.com
with no authentication if there is no config file provided.
python-gitlab will now also only look for configuration
in the provided PYTHON_GITLAB_CFG path, instead of merging
it with user- and system-wide config files. If the
environment variable is defined and the file cannot be
opened, python-gitlab will now explicitly fail.

<title>fix!: raise error if there is a 301/302 redirection</title>

Before we raised an error if there was a 301, 302 redirect but only
from an http URL to an https URL.  But we didn't raise an error for
any other redirects.

This caused two problems:

  1. PUT requests that are redirected get changed to GET requests
     which don't perform the desired action but raise no error. This
     is because the GET response succeeds but since it wasn't a PUT it
     doesn't update. See issue:
     https://github.com/python-gitlab/python-gitlab/issues/1432
  2. POST requests that are redirected also got changed to GET
     requests. They also caused hard to debug tracebacks for the user.
     See issue:
     https://github.com/python-gitlab/python-gitlab/issues/1477

Correct this by always raising a RedirectError exception and improve
the exception message to let them know what was redirected.
